I really miss the 3 days lost service any time we had a heavy rain. Or the time it quit because a nest of ants had built their house in the pedestal at the end of the lane. Or when lightning would strike near the line and make the phone ring one time. And the best part was the party line. As a kid, our teenage neighbor had a girlfriend and they’d call each other and when they ran out of things to say, they’d just set there with the silence punctuated occasionally by a heavy sigh. My dad was a kid in the hand crank phone days. His aunt and the neighbor ladies would all get on the phone at the same time for a big hen party. When those old gals couldn’t talk fast enough in English they’d switch to German and really go then. Sometimes so many people would be on the line at once that the volume got so low nothing could be heard and a few would have to hang up.
